No Wastebasket ...... After Update

Hi All

Yesterday i ran pacman -Syu and Thunar was upgraded, but now i dont have the Wastebasket in the left hand tree when i start Thunar !

Any ideas as to how i get it back please ?

Xfce got updated to 4.8 and the new version of Thunar needs gvfs for Trash. Also if you're considering PCManFM, it needs gvfs for Trash too.

It works when you launch thunar with:

dbus-launch thunar

I had the same issue with Awesome.
